Output 2866d511e0b3e6a5cc9763c35d76de0820f728656beb57516df333d783777dd2:9

value
3085087
script pubkey
OP_0 OP_PUSHBYTES_20 c98ccdca5aa2fc75d30025a9e6859b22f4416a28
address
bc1qexxvmjj65t78t5cqyk57dpvmyt6yz63g9mz3n4
transaction
2866d511e0b3e6a5cc9763c35d76de0820f728656beb57516df333d783777dd2